Discover Hidden Gems with Questing: NYC's Unique Riddle-Based Walking Tours!
Step off the beaten path and explore New York City in a way you never imagined with Questing, a phone-based walking-tour experience that blends history, adventure, and fun.
Perfect for team-building events, date nights, tourists, or locals, these tours lead you through the iconic streets of Greenwich Village, the Financial District, and Brooklyn Heights, uncovering secret spots and fascinating historical facts.
Start your journey at a cozy coffee shop, solve engaging puzzles, and finish with a celebratory drink at a local bar! It's the ultimate way to experience NYC’s charm while embracing your inner detective.
If you love scavenger hunts, escape rooms, geocaching, or just discovering the city’s hidden beauty, Questing is a must-do activity.
